Transaction 6a53d90978986454ed84f5b1b7ab60dac8494a432f884b2d04d9604066822ecd
1 Input
1 Output
-
6a53d90978986454ed84f5b1b7ab60dac8494a432f884b2d04d9604066822ecd:0
- value
- 978286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1a05d6720ef2338af682d644dca204a923cc047 OP_EQUAL
- address
- 3Pict7w5N25PcTCxqZrqKhJMz6E1eh8w1G